765 patients with different forms of arterial hypertension, having cerebrovascular insufficiency, were examined. Correlations of parameters of cerebral and system hemodynamics, microcirculation and functional state of the central nervous system under conditions of controlled physical exercise were studied. The prognostic significance of the early objectivization of initial manifestations of cerebral circulation insufficiency before development of arterial hypertension in preclinical and early clinical stages of brain vascular diseases and the possibil ity of de term in ing functional reserves of cerebral neurodynamics and hemodynamics were shown.
